WebFor your ongoing sessions, you can expect about a 30-minute to one-hour commitment. Frequency can range from once a week to multiple times, depending on the severity of your injury or condition and the goals of your therapy program. As you make progress in your program, your visits may change in both length and frequency. WebThe Master of Science in Physical Therapy (MScPT) is a 24-month professional graduate program leading to entry to practice. The program is accredited by Physiotherapy Education Accreditation Canada (PEAC). Graduates will be eligible to write the Physiotherapy Competency Examination (PCE), administered by the Canadian Alliance of Physiotherapy ...

WebIn order to represent the scope of its work, the Society adopts its present name 'The Chartered Society of Physiotherapy'. 1951. The CSP is a founding member of the World Confederation of Physical Therapy. In 1953 the first WCPT Congress (video above) is organised by the CSP and held at the Central Methodist Hall in London. 1953.
